Company Description

The Australasian Corrosion Association (ACA) is a not-for-profit membership association committed to disseminating information on corrosion and its prevention or control. Through training, seminars, conferences, publications and other activities, we provide our members with the knowledge and networking opportunities they need to excel in this field. Our vision is to manage corrosion sustainably and cost-effectively to ensure the health and safety of the community and protection of the environment. Our mission is to help society manage the impact of corrosion on asset durability.

Role Description

The Warehouse Coordinator is an integral member of the ACA team delivering high quality training programs throughout Australia and New Zealand. The role is responsible for managing training related equipment and materials such as the coatings inspection gauges, cathodic protection demonstration equipment, and other related equipment and consumables (including training manuals) for corrosion-related training. This role also organises freight consignments inwards and outwards of the ACA training kits, places and manages consumable orders, and ensures a safe working environment at the ACA warehouse.
